Yes.

Short answer but not really another one.

The bolts need a sound method of locking them in place. Nyloc (yuk) nuts, spring washers or lock tabs is about all there is.

Or you are handy with a very small drill and locking wire pliers,

I agree Nyloc nuts are not the best, more so as just about 100% of the ones you get in the UK are far east imported parts of dubious quality, you can get an All Metal Self Locking nut which will take a lot more stick than a Nyloc, but with any sort of Self Locking Nut the max usage is on and off 5 times only.
